Grosjean expects equal treatment

Romain Grosjean believes he will begin this season "sportingly" on equal footing to team-mate Kimi Raikkonen. Teaming up at Lotus for the first time last season, both Grosjean and Raikkonen had a solid start to the campaign. But while Raikkonen went on to win the Abu Dhabi GP and take third place in the Drivers' standings, Grosjean's season faltered and he was even banned for one race after causing an accident too many. This year, the Frenchman expects the two will again start with equal treatment from Lotus despite the team "surfing" on Raikkonen's name.
